# Transport of Master Keys

This page covers movement of the Thornevale building master key set between the facilities office and the dispatch desk. The keys travel only in the tamper-evident pouch, never loose, and never overnight in the depot. Two staff must log the pouch out, and the courier from Ashgrove Secure must present photo identification. At the moment of hand-over, follow the confidential instruction stated directly below.

dispatch memo: the eliath belael courier leaves the praox ledger at gate 8841 under passcode 017589

TICKET — Restock planner vault locked

The Cartwell vending-machine restock planner failed its nightly sync because the secrets vault sealed itself after a timeout during rotation. No data was lost; route plans for tomorrow are cached. Before the 06:00 release cut, the vault must be reopened so the planner can fetch depot credentials. Unseal it via the Norvik console using the recovery passphrase below.

strongbox words: praath-queniel-holax-druael-jorath-noveth-druok

Ticket #—: Config vault locked, hot-reload stalled

Severity: High. The Emberline config service can't hot-reload because its backing vault sealed itself after three failed token renewals overnight. Services are running on stale config; any flag flips or rate-limit changes will not propagate until the vault is unsealed. No restart needed — once unsealed, the watcher picks up changes within 30 seconds. Verify by flipping the canary flag in staging. To unseal, open the vault console on the bastion and enter the passphrase below.

unlock words, hahip-baduf: holwyn-istath-julvan